The Women's Resource Center is looking for a motivated, organized and skillful person to fill in the position of Administrative Assistant 3. The Women’s Resource Center is a place of advocacy, support, and safety for all members of the University of New Mexico and greater community who feel passionate about enhancing success within academic, personal, and professional aspects of students’ lives. The individual in this role will perform and/or oversee a variety of associated administrative, fiscal, staff support, and planning activities, some of which require advanced or specialized knowledge and skills, such as budget administration and control, equipment, facilities, and inventory management, specialized recordkeeping and database management, and/or specified information-gathering projects and tasks. They will also coordinate and facilitate meetings, program functions, and/or center special events, as appropriate with the Women's Resource Center guidelines. Training and overseeing the center's Office Assistants will also be included. You will be the direct point of contact of the Women's Resource Center for all the UNM and further community, which will require excellent customer service skills and patience relaying the same information repetitively.

Minimum Qualifications High school diploma or GED; at least 5 years of experience directly related to the duties and responsibilities specified.
Completed degree(s) from an accredited institution that are above the minimum education requirement may be substituted for experience on a year for year basis.
